SpaceX Nasa Mission: Astronauts on historic mission enter space station - BSpaceX Nasa Mission: Astronauts on historic mission enter space station - B External linkNasa's Doug Hurley and Bob Behnken complete their 19-hour flight to the orbiting laboratory.TagsContent typeLINK